Web2. Pour half a cup of fabric softener into a clean bucket with a gallon of lukewarm water and stir well before using it. 3. Next, fill a spray bottle with the solution and spray over the entire carpet. Allow about 3 minutes for the solution to set. 4. Lastly, rinse and extract the carpet with clean water for a soft and fluffy carpet. WebOct 25, 2024 · This will fluff up matted carpet, removing the ground-in dirt in the process.
